Cappadocia is a unique region in Turkey known for its extraordinary lunar landscape, rock formations sculpted by erosion and its ancient underground cities such as Derinkuyu and Kaymaklı, which were built by the region's inhabitants as shelters during times of war and persecution. One of the most distinctive features of Cappadocia are the "fairy chimneys", cone-shaped rock formations that rise from the ground, creating a surreal landscape. In addition to its stunning scenery, Cappadocia is a popular destination for hot air balloon flights, offering panoramic views of the entire region at sunrise or sunset.
